Default Scion head units in Toyota Echos

Do all Scion head units work with Toyota Echo's?

I've been lurking around and searching other forums, but there's no mention of which years and which year Echos.

I'm planning on putting it into a 2005 Echo

I have a 2005 1cd Scion HU that was a direct fit into my echo, the factory toyota harness fit perfectly, and the mounting plates lined up perfectly. takes like 15mins max to install
